When I got my 50's Classic Stratocaster, I noticed that the neck was set at a very slight angle to the body, causing the low E-string to veer off to the very edge of the fretboard at the last frets. There was also a chip in the finish at the neck pocket (although I knew about that when I bought the guitar; you can see it in the pictures from the eBay auction). A mere mortal might have been miffed (love that alliteration!), but luckily, I rock. I loosened the strings and removed all but one neck bolt, added a super tiny shim made from a Fender "thin" pick between the side of the neck and the pocket, and reset the neck. Perfect! I then put my art skills into action. It took me about five minutes to mix an exact match to the Daphne Blue paint (all that college is paying off now! LOL), and the chip is gone.
